To adjust a self-closing door hinge, you can typically adjust the tension by turning the tension screw located on the hinge. By tightening or loosening the screw, you can control how quickly the door closes. It may require some trial and error to find the right tension for your door.

How to adjust a spring hinge on a door?

To adjust a spring hinge on a door, use a screwdriver to tighten or loosen the tension screws on the hinge. Turning the screws clockwise will increase tension, while turning them counterclockwise will decrease tension. Experiment with small adjustments until the door closes properly.

How do you adjust an Anderson french door hinge?

To adjust an Anderson French door hinge, first, use a screwdriver to loosen the screws on the hinge plate. You can then shift the door up or down as needed to align it properly with the frame. For lateral adjustments, you may need to slightly reposition the hinge itself. After making the adjustments, tighten the screws securely and check the door's operation to ensure it opens and closes smoothly.

What is the process for creating a hinge mortise in a wooden door frame?

To create a hinge mortise in a wooden door frame, you will need to mark the location of the hinge on the door frame, use a chisel and hammer to carefully remove the wood within the marked area to the depth of the hinge, and then test the fit of the hinge in the mortise. Adjust as needed for a snug fit before attaching the hinge to the door frame.

How can I properly shim a door hinge?

To properly shim a door hinge, you can place thin pieces of material, like cardboard or wood, behind the hinge to adjust its position and make the door fit properly in the frame. Make sure the shims are snug and secure before tightening the hinge screws.


How can I adjust a self-closing door hinge to ensure it functions properly?

To adjust a self-closing door hinge, use a screwdriver to tighten or loosen the tension screw on the hinge. Turning the screw clockwise increases tension, making the door close faster, while turning it counterclockwise decreases tension, making the door close slower. Experiment with adjustments until the door closes properly.
